Globe Telecom Inc. has successfully piloted its next-gen 50GPON (50 Gigabit Passive Optical Network) technology, advancing beyond the limitations of current 10GPON systems. Conducted at Globe’s Valero Telepark in Makati City, the trial demonstrated the technology’s ability to deliver data speeds of up to 50 Gbps, a significant leap in broadband capabilities.
The breakthrough promises to enhance network efficiency, reduce latency, and support the growing demands of both residential and business users. With practical applications such as 8K streaming, cloud gaming, AR/VR, and fiber-to-the-room services, the technology is poised to revolutionize digital experiences across various sectors, including smart cities, telemedicine, and enterprise connectivity.
